[...] so yeah, tips on sleeping easiest would be lovely. x]
I have so many although they don't work for me. XD;

- no caffeine/alcohol within four hours of your intended bedtime
- no LCD screens within one hour
- don't use your bed for anything but sleeping (it's best to not use your room at all for anything but sleeping but I know that's not an option for most people)
- no exercise within one hour
- wake up at the same time every day
- ...and try not to sleep in or take naps
- spend more time outside during the day
- try to keep noise/light out of your room when you're trying to sleep

Some of these are pretty obvious but you don't even realize you do them... or I don't... like the light in your room thing. I actually covered up my window recently and the lack of seeing a glimmer of streetlights helped immensely!
